用户提问: ai设计好学吗
Ai回答: AI(人工智能)设计是一个广泛的领域,涵盖了多个学科和技术。学习AI设计可能具有挑战性,但只要具备正确的资源、动力和实践,任何人都可以掌握它。以下是一些需要考虑的方面:
需要学习的关键技能:
1、编程技能:Python是AI和机器学习(ML)最常用的编程语言之一。熟悉Python及其相关库,如NumPy、pandas和scikit-learn,是必不可少的。
2、数学:线性代数、微积分、概率论和统计学是理解AI和ML概念的基础。
3、数据结构和算法:了解图、树和数组等数据结构,以及搜索、排序和图算法等算法,对于AI编程至关重要。
4、机器学习框架:熟悉流行的ML框架,如TensorFlow、PyTorch或Keras,对于构建和训练AI模型是必要的。
5、深度学习:深度学习是AI的一个子集,专注于神经网络。了解卷积神经网络(CNN)、循环神经网络(RNN)和递归神经网络(RNN)等概念至关重要。
6、特定领域知识:根据您感兴趣的AI应用领域,您可能需要学习计算机视觉、自然语言处理(NLP)或强化学习等特定主题。
学习资源:
1、在线课程:
* Coursera:斯坦福大学的机器学习,吴恩达的机器学习课程
* edX:麻省理工学院的AI导论,哈佛大学的AI课程
* Udemy:各种AI和ML课程
2、书籍:
* 帕特里克·马修斯(Patrick Mathews)的《Python机器学习》(Python Machine Learning)
* 汤姆·米切尔(Tom Mitchell)的《机器学习》(Machine Learning)
* 伊恩·古德费洛(Ian Goodfellow)、约舒亚·本吉奥(Yoshua Bengio)和阿龙·库维尔(Aaron Courville)的《深度学习》(Deep Learning)
3、教程和博客:
* KDnuggets:一个流行的AI和ML博客和教程网站
* Towards Data Science:在Medium上的AI和ML文章和教程
* AI Alignment Forum:一个专注于AI安全和对齐的研究社区
4、实践和项目:
* Kaggle:一个流行的平台,用于托管与AI和ML相关的竞赛和项目
* GitHub:浏览开源AI项目和仓库
学习AI设计的提示:
1、从基础开始:从编程、数学和数据结构的基础开始。
2、专注于一个领域:选择一个特定的AI领域(例如,计算机视觉、NLP),并深入学习。
3、加入在线社区:参与在线论坛,如Kaggle、Reddit的r/MachineLearning和r/AI,以及Stack Overflow,与其他AI爱好者交流。
4、做项目:将您的知识应用于现实世界的项目或练习,以巩固学习。
5、随时了解最新发展:关注AI研究论文、博客和会议(例如,NIPS,IJCAI),以了解最新进展。
时间投入:
学习人工智能设计需要大量的时间投入,但投入的程度取决于你的目标和当前的知识水平。以下是粗略的估计:
* 基础理解:1-3个月 学习AI和ML的基础知识,包括编程技能和数学基础。
* 中级技能:6-12个月 深入研究特定的AI领域,如计算机视觉或NLP,并构建简单的模型。
* 高级技能:1-2年或以上 掌握高级概念,如深度学习,并在复杂项目中应用它们。
记住,学习AI设计是一条终身的旅程。保持好奇心,坚持不懈,并乐于学习,你就能在这一领域取得显著进步。
0
IP地址: 242.208.59.183
搜索次数: 5
提问时间: 2025-04-20 13:39:50
热门提问:
vue ai应用
ai渐变图形
ai人工智能视频
ai实时翻译工具
ai可以做视频嘛
友情链接:
月饼
Us search engine